O R D E R

This Writ petition is filed for issuing a Writ of Mandamus, to direct the respondents to grant protection and permission to arrange light and sound system to conduct the festival of erecting "Muhurthakal" on 16.10.2017, inviting "Theerthakudam" on 26.10.2017 and "Kumbabhisekam" scheduled to be held on 27.10.2017 in Arulmighu Sree Kaliamman and Arulmighu Baghavathiamman Kovil situated at Rayappa Goundanur, Sembiyanatham Village, Kadvur Taluk, Karur District.

2.Heard the learned counsel appearing for the petitioner and the learned Additional Government Pleader appearing for the respondent.

Executive Magistrate also conduct a Peace Committee Meeting, after issuing notice to the two groups. From the resolution passed in the Peace Committee Meeting, it can be seen that one group has not agree and they are walked out from the meeting. It is thereafter a Trust has been formed by other faction on 04.08.2017 and when it was on the basis of the Trust deed, the petitioner has now approached this Court for conducting the programme and for getting police protection for all the programmes, which has been arranged by the petitioner and his group.

4.Since, there is dispute, it is evident from the typed set of papers filed by the petitioner before this Court, this Court is not in a position to suggest a viable solution as the rival parties are not before this Court. Having regard to the facts and circumstances of this Court, the petitioner is advised to approach the Civil Court for appropriate relief after impleading the rival group. With the said observation, this petition is closed.

5. With the above observation, the Writ Petition is disposed of. No costs.
